To a suspension of N′-(6-(2-chlorophenyl)-5-(4-chlorophenyl)pyridazin-3-yl)-2-cyclohexylacetohydrazide (46 mg, 0.1 mmol) in THF (2 mL) at room temperature was added diisopropylethylamine (0.14 mL, 0.8 mmol). After 5 min, triphenylphosphine dichloride (110 mg, 0.33 mmol) was added, and the reaction mixture stirred at room temperature for 16 h. Analysis by HPLC/MS indicated the reaction was complete. The reaction was diluted with EtOAc (40 mL), washed with H2O, saturated aqueous NaCl, dried (Na2SO4), filtered and concentrated. The obtained residue was purified using a silica gel cartridge (12 g) eluting with a gradient of EtOAc (0-30%) in hexanes to yield 45 mg of the desired product with 80% purity (contaminated with triphenylphosphine oxide). The product was further purified using reverse phase preparative HPLC (Conditions: Phenomenex Luna 5 μC18 21.2×100 mm; Eluted with 70% to 100% B, 8 min gradient, 100% B hold for 7 min, (A=90% H2O, 10% MeOH and B=10% H2O, 90% MeOH); Flow rate at 20 mL/min, UV detection at 220 nm) to afford 30 mg (68%) of the title compound as a white powder. HPLC/MS (method A): retention time=4.22 min, (M+H)+=437.1. 1H NMR (CDCl3, 400 MHz): δ 8.03 (s, 1H), 7.33-7.41 (m, 4H), 7.21-7.28 (m, 2H), 7.07 (d, J=8.31Hz, 2H), 3.14 (d, J=7.09 Hz, 2H), 2.01-2.12 (m, 1H), 1.69-1.80 (m, 4H), 1.21-1.29 (m, 3H), 1.10-1.17 (m, 3H).
